The Medina County Society for the Prevention of Cruelty to Animals, Inc., a 501(c)(3) non-profit humane society that was established in 1985, is overseen locally by a volunteer board of directors. Our federal identification number is 34-1507786.

Medina County Animal Shelter

It's first come, first served for all adoptions. To adopt, you must be 18 years old. The $64 adoption fee also covers the cost of a Medina County dog tag, which is required.
